SUMMARY:NOW 2025: Week One - Maylee Todd\, Jacob Wolff\, Diana Wyenn and Ammunition Theatre Company
DESCRIPTION:The 22nd annual New Original Works kicks off with a program of works by Maylee Todd\, Jacob Wolff\, Diana Wyenn and Ammunition Theatre Company. \nBUY A FESTIVAL PASS! SEE ALL 9 WORKS FOR $50! \n  \nMaylee Todd\nMOUTH \nPart surreal cabaret\, part psychological spiral\, MOUTH is a journey through the chaos of identity and mental health. This boundary-blurring performance fuses music\, raw humor\, video projections\, and inflatable set design to create an unsettling yet ecstatic experience. Highlighting songs from her forthcoming LP\, Maylee Todd shapeshifts as she tells stories of attraction\, self-doubt\, and endurance in a sonic and visual fever dream. \n  \nJacob Wolff\nBEG \nIn this experimental opera\, Jacob Wolff (Music BFA 23) takes up the rodeo clown—a figure who endures physical danger and humiliation for the audience’s entertainment—to consider the tension between performance\, risk\, and self-deprecation. Incorporating live and pre-recorded electronic music\, dance\, theater\, and improvisation\, BEG seeks to dissolve the boundaries between performers\, audience\, and performance space. Ordinary materials like ladders and wood transform into dynamic elements of set design\, as movements and tasks set up physical challenges in an exploration of spectacle\, sacrifice\, and labor. \n  \nDiana Wyenn and Ammunition Theatre Company\nI Am an American (via Los Angeles) \nWhat is it to be living in the United States of America today? What are the challenges of participating in a democracy that was built without many of us in mind? Performed by an ensemble whose identities and perspectives reflect the diversity of Los Angeles\, this production illuminates the lives of a cross section of Angelenos today. Weaving together autobiographical accounts\, song\, and spectacle\, I Am an American (via Los Angeles) is an intimate\, honest\, and searing look at being in relationship with ideas of America\, conceived and directed by Diana Wyenn\, and devised with LA-based Ammunition Theatre Company. \n  \nNOW 2025: Week One will be presented as one shared program of all three works on Thursday\, Friday\, and Saturday. \nPlease note: MOUTH contains mature content and loud sounds; BEG contains nudity\, mature content\, flashing lights\, and loud sounds; I Am an American (via Los Angeles) contains mature content and flashing lights.  \n\nDiscounts available for REDCAT members\, students & the CalArts faculty and staff

SUMMARY:Alonzo King LINES Ballet
DESCRIPTION:“Brilliant” —San Francisco Chronicle \nExperience an evening of electrifying choreography with two recent works by visionary choreographer Alonzo King. “Ode to Alice Coltrane” explores Coltrane’s spiritual soundscapes\, diving into the composer\, pianist\, and harpist’s masterpieces\, including Journey In Satchidananda\, recognized as one of the greatest albums of all time by Rolling Stone. The program also captures the imaginative storytelling of Maurice Ravel in Ma mère l’Oye as the company puts a contemporary twist on Ravel’s 1912 suite of Mother Goose fairy tales.

SUMMARY:NOW 2025: Week Two - Gabriela Burdsall; Orin Calcagne and Jenson Titus; Divya Victor\, Carolyn Chen\, AMOC*
DESCRIPTION:The 22nd annual New Original Works continues with a program of works by Gabriela Burdsall; Orin Calcagne and Jenson Titus; and Divya Victor\, Carolyn Chen\, AMOC*. \nBUY A FESTIVAL PASS! SEE ALL 9 WORKS FOR $50! \n  \nGabriela Burdsall\nMENEO \nGabriela Burdsall presents the body as a fluid canvas for identity\, resistance\, and celebration in this solo dance performance. The artist takes up el meneo\, a movement rooted in Caribbean social dances\, in conversation with la clave\, the core syncopated rhythm of Cuban music\, in a dynamic interplay between rhythm\, body\, and cultural heritage. MENEO presents dance as a fleeting monument that questions power and its political symbols. As Burdsall’s body meanders and sways\, she moves between trance-like states of ecstasy and introspection. Her raw physical presence becomes a vessel for primal energy\, as the pulse viscerally binds her to history. \n  \nOrin Calcagne and Jenson Titus\nMommy \nMommy is a comedy-horror play about a family plagued by their mother’s mental illness. When Daddy announces that he will be moving his homosexual lover into the family home\, an already unstable Mommy is pushed past her limit and descends into emotional chaos\, dragging the rest of her family down with her.  In this surreal family farce\, the artists utilize their clowning backgrounds to bring humor to painful circumstances. A live foley soundscape and musical score composed and performed by Cleo Henman bring further texture to this absurd melodrama. Mommy ultimately uses comedy to dissect relationship dynamics and traditional norms in an exploration of what makes society sick. \n  \nDivya Victor\, Carolyn Chen\, AMOC*\nThresholds \nIn Thresholds\, composer Carolyn Chen presents a musical adaptation of poems from Divya Victor’s books KITH and CURB\, which explore immigrant experiences of everyday life amidst racist violence in the United States. Reading selections live\, Victor traces an arc of arrival\, assimilation\, and loss as immigrants move through the paperwork of visas and citizenship\, mythic underpinnings of air travel\, diasporic memories of homeland\, and white-supremacist violence against South Asians. The music responds to the expressivity of Victor’s text with notated compositions and improvised materials developed for an ensemble integrating Western and Carnatic music assembled by American Modern Opera Company (AMOC*). \n  \nNOW 2025: Week Two will be presented as one shared program of all three works on Thursday\, Friday\, and Saturday.  \nPlease note: Mommy contains mature content\, loud sounds\, gunshot sounds\, and mentions of suicide and self-harm. \n\n* Discounts available for REDCAT members\, students & the CalArts faculty and staff

SUMMARY:NOW 2025: Week Three - Lu Coy\, jeremy de’jon guyton\, Luna Izpisua Rodriguez
DESCRIPTION:The 22nd annual New Original Works concludes with a program of works by Lu Coy\, jeremy de’jon guyton\, and Luna Izpisua Rodriguez. \nBUY A FESTIVAL PASS! SEE ALL 9 WORKS FOR $50! \n  \nLu Coy \nBecoming the Moon \nLu Coy (Music Performer Composer MFA 18) crafts an opera that illuminates the Florentine Codex’s account of Tecciztecatl—a gender-expansive Mexica moon deity. Blending original poetry with translation of the 16th-century Nahuatl manuscript\, this performance unfolds through song\, animation\, storytelling\, and movement. Guiding audiences through transcestral memory\, Coy conjures a retelling that connects to their own lived experiences of the ache and radiance of transfeminine rebirth. Excavating queer narratives from colonial materials\, Coy combines experimental electronic music with virtuosic vocal performance and pre-Columbian instrumentation in an examination of the beauty found under the cover of darkness. \n  \njeremy de’jon guyton \nnotes on building a foundation\, 1963 \nBlending lyrical text\, fluid movement\, and nostalgic audio-visual elements drawn from his own family archive\, this poetic autofiction by jeremy de’jon guyton is a meditation on legacy\, displacement\, and the urgent desire for sanctuary. notes on building a foundation\, 1963 brings audiences into a survival bunker where memory\, movement\, and myth converge as Q.S. excavates ancestral artifacts from their family’s flight Westward in 1963 and stories passed down over three generations. As Los Angeles fires\, both literal and political\, force new waves of migration\, this interdisciplinary dance performance asks: How do we preserve what matters when the world around us is burning? This timely performance dares to reimagine survival through the unrelenting search for home. \n\nLuna Izpisua Rodriguez \nOpen House \nAt the foreclosure sale of a beachfront home in Southern California\, a realtor masked in plastic surgery feeds the desperation of ownership. Two first-time buyers grip each other in the primary closet\, lost in the fantasy of a real estate flipper. Neighbors walk around nervously—who will be next? Visitors test the way their bodies sink into the shiny staging sofa\, unaware that a coyote is nursing her young in the guest room. The ghosts of California’s keepers and takers slip out through the cracks in the drywall. Yet no matter what befalls\, no one relinquishes the desperate belief that this land can be possessed. Directed by Luna Izpisua Rodriguez (Art and Theater Directing MFA 24)\, Open House is a meditation on erosion\, both geological and psychic—on how losing land can feel like losing self. \n\nNOW 2025: Week Three will be presented as one shared program of all three works on Thursday\, Friday\, and Saturday.  \nPlease note: Becoming the Moon and notes on building a foundation\, 1963 contain loud sounds; Open House contains nudity and mature content. \nBecoming the Moon was made possible in part by a Foundation for the Contemporary Arts Emergency Grant. \n\n Discounts available for REDCAT members\, students & the CalArts faculty and staff
